Understanding Car Key Types
Before delving into the reprogramming procedure, it's vital to comprehend the different types of car keys. The most typical types include:

Traditional Mechanical Keys: The most basic kind of a car key, which runs the lock and ignition utilizing a mechanical system.

Transponder Keys: These keys include a small chip that interacts with the car's ignition system, making it harder for burglars to take the vehicle.

Key Fobs: These remote-controlled gadgets make it possible for keyless entry and may also permit keyless ignition.

Smart Keys: Linked to advanced keyless entry systems, wise keys offer the ultimate convenience, enabling the driver to begin the vehicle with the touch of a button.

Understanding these key types is important as the programming actions can vary considerably.
Why Reprogramming is Necessary
Reprogramming a car key might be required for numerous reasons, including:

Lost or Stolen Keys: If a key is lost or presumed to be taken, reprogramming is vital to ensure the car remains safe and secure.

Changing an Old Key: When a vehicle owner gets a new key, the old key may require to be programmed to avoid it from working.

Battery Replacement: Changing the battery in a key fob may often need reprogramming to bring back performance.

Malfunctioning Key: If a key is malfunctioning, reprogramming might fix the problem.

While the process is typically uncomplicated, there are typical problems that can arise during reprogramming:

Incorrect Sequence: Failing to follow the ignition series properly can result in failure to get in programming mode.

Malfunctioning Key: If the brand-new key is defective or harmed, it might not program appropriately.

Vehicle Settings: Some cars require specific settings or conditions (like remaining in Park) for effective programming.

Missing Tools: Sometimes, additional tools or codes may be required, specifically for high-security systems.
